static void checkAlarms(subRecord *prec)
|
||
{
|
||
double val, hyst, lalm;
|
||
double alev;
|
||
epicsEnum16 asev;
|
||
|
||
if (prec->udf) {
|
||
recGblSetSevr(prec, UDF_ALARM, prec->udfs);
|
||
return;
|
||
}
|
||
|
||
val = prec->val;
|
||
hyst = prec->hyst;
|
||
lalm = prec->lalm;
|
||
|
||
/* alarm condition hihi */
|
||
asev = prec->hhsv;
|
||
alev = prec->hihi;
|
||
if (asev && (val >= alev || ((lalm == alev) && (val >= alev - hyst)))) {
|
||
if (recGblSetSevr(prec, HIHI_ALARM, asev))
|
||
prec->lalm = alev;
|
||
return;
|
||
}
|
||
|
||
/* alarm condition lolo */
|
||
asev = prec->llsv;
|
||
alev = prec->lolo;
|
||
if (asev && (val <= alev || ((lalm == alev) && (val <= alev + hyst)))) {
|
||
if (recGblSetSevr(prec, LOLO_ALARM, asev))
|
||
prec->lalm = alev;
|
||
return;
|
||
}
|
||
|
||
/* alarm condition high */
|
||
asev = prec->hsv;
|
||
alev = prec->high;
|
||
if (asev && (val >= alev || ((lalm == alev) && (val >= alev - hyst)))) {
|
||
if (recGblSetSevr(prec, HIGH_ALARM, asev))
|
||
prec->lalm = alev;
|
||
return;
|
||
}
|
||
|
||
/* alarm condition low */
|
||
asev = prec->lsv;
|
||
alev = prec->low;
|
||
if (asev && (val <= alev || ((lalm == alev) && (val <= alev + hyst)))) {
|
||
if (recGblSetSevr(prec, LOW_ALARM, asev))
|
||
prec->lalm = alev;
|
||
return;
|
||
}
|
||
|
||
/* we get here only if val is out of alarm by at least hyst */
|
||
prec->lalm = val;
|
||
return;
|
||
}
